• Choosing between a cross flow fan and an axial fan can make or break your HVAC system's performance. Axial fans excel at moving large volumes of air with low static pressure, making them ideal for condensers, cooling towers, and industrial ventilation. Cross flow fans, on the other hand, deliver a wide, uniform curtain of air with quieter operation, perfect for wall-mounted ACs, fan coil units, and air curtains. The right choice depends on your airflow needs, static pressure requirements, installation space, and noise tolerance.
